From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Delay of a material changeover for induction pipes and carburetters from cast iron to aluminium.

In view of the fact that Hs.{Lord Ernest Hives - Chair} is not of the opinion that the changeover from cast iron to aluminium on the induction pipes and carburetter justifies even £51. of scrap, we have decided to use up all the castings we have in stock, and to bring in the changeover on C.2.b. instead of C.2.a.

Will the D.O. kindly modify their instructions to this effect, which will continue to use all the old carburettors up to the end of the first 100 of C.2. Series, that is, C.2.a, and Tool Dept. should note that we agree it will be necessary for new jigs to be made in connection with a number of the parts on the carburetter body.
